Katalog książek

Wydawnictwo Helion

Helion SA
ul. Kościuszki 1c
44-100 Gliwice
tel. (32) 230-98-63




© Helion 1991-2012

Lauret zaufanych opinii
Informacje podstawowe
C++. Wykorzystaj potęgę aplikacji graficznych. eBook

C++. Wykorzystaj potęgę aplikacji graficznych. eBook

Autorzy: Janusz Ganczarski, Mariusz Owczarek
Data wydania: 2012/02
Cena: 29.00

W formacie:  PDF  ePub  Mobi

Do przechowalni
Dodaj cppwyk_ebook

» Kup wydanie papierowe » Znak wodny » Pomoc
Szczegóły:
  • Oznakowanie: Znak wodny
  • ISBN: 9788324645015 / 978-83-246-4501-5
  • Stron: 448 (w wersji papierowej)
  • Numer z katalogu: 8272

Informacje dodatkowe:
okładka wersji papierowej
Wydanie
papierowe
C++. Wykorzystaj potęgę aplikacji graficznych

Autorzy: Janusz Ganczarski, Mariusz Owczarek
Cena książki: 69.00zł Dodaj do koszyka

Napisz wieloplatformowe programy w C++

  • Jak korzystać z bibliotek wxWidgets oraz Qt?
  • W jaki sposób implementować obsługę zdarzeń w aplikacjach?
  • Jak budować aplikacje sieciowe i bazodanowe?

Okres dominacji jednego systemu operacyjnego i przeznaczonych dla niego rozwiązań powoli odchodzi do historii. Fenomen popularności różnych dystrybucji Linuksa i coraz mocniejsza pozycja komputerów Mac sprawiają, że wiele firm produkujących oprogramowanie decyduje się na tworzenie rozwiązań wieloplatformowych. W przypadku ogromnych korporacji stworzenie zespołów programistycznych pracujących równolegle nad kilkoma wersjami jednej aplikacji dla różnych systemów operacyjnych nie stanowi problemu, ale w mniejszych firmach jest to niemożliwe. Tu z pomocą przychodzą biblioteki pozwalające na tworzenie kodu źródłowego prawidłowo kompilującego się na każdej platformie, na której je zainstalowano.

Książka "C++. Wykorzystaj potęgę aplikacji graficznych" opisuje tworzenie oprogramowania z wykorzystaniem dwóch takich właśnie bibliotek - wxWidgets oraz Qt. Czytając ją, dowiesz się, jak wykorzystać język C++ i środowisko Dev-C++ do pisania programów, z których korzystać będą mogli użytkownicy systemu Windows, Linuksa i Mac OS. Nauczysz się stosować kontrolki i komponenty, budować menu i interfejsy użytkownika, obsługiwać zdarzenia i implementować operacje graficzne. Przeczytasz także o aplikacjach bazodanowych i sieciowych. Każde z zagadnień omówiono zarówno w kontekście biblioteki wxWidgets, jak i biblioteki Qt, dzięki czemu poznasz dwie metody rozwiązywania tych samych zadań programistycznych - by wybrać sobie tę, która bardziej Ci odpowiada.

  • Instalacja środowiska programistycznego i bibliotek
  • Struktura aplikacji i podstawowe komponenty
  • Stosowanie komponentów
  • Obsługa zdarzeń myszy i klawiatury
  • Budowanie menu aplikacji
  • Komunikacja sieciowa
  • Operacje graficzne
  • Połączenia z bazami danych
  • Drukowanie z poziomu aplikacji

Dzięki tej książce stworzysz aplikacje, które docenią użytkownicy wszystkich systemów operacyjnych.


Zobacz wszystkie książki tych autorów »
Osoby, które kupowały tę książkę, często kupowały też:
<strong><a href="/ksiazki/maalpr.htm" style="color:black;" title="Od matematyki do programowania. Wszystko, co każdy programista wiedzieć powinien">Od matematyki do programowania. Wszystko, co każdy programista wiedzieć powinien</a></strong><br/> <img src="/img/45.gif" class="stars" /> <table cellpadding="0" cellspacing="0" style="margin:0 auto;"> <tr> <td style="width:129px;height:24px;background:url(/img/tlopodkoszyk2.gif) no-repeat scroll 0 4px;padding-left:5px;"> <b>Cena: 37.95 zł</b> </td><td> <a href="/zakupy/add.cgi?id=maalpr"><img class="stars" src="/img/koszyk2.gif" alt="Dodaj maalpr" /></a> </td> </tr> </table> <strong><a href="/ksiazki/cwcp11.htm" style="color:black;" title="C++11. Nowy standard. Ćwiczenia">C++11. Nowy standard. Ćwiczenia</a></strong><br/> <img src="/img/4.gif" class="stars" /> <table cellpadding="0" cellspacing="0" style="margin:0 auto;"> <tr> <td style="width:129px;height:24px;background:url(/img/tlopodkoszyk2.gif) no-repeat scroll 0 4px;padding-left:5px;"> <b>Cena: 21.90 zł</b> </td><td> <a href="/zakupy/add.cgi?id=cwcp11"><img class="stars" src="/img/koszyk2.gif" alt="Dodaj cwcp11" /></a> </td> </tr> </table> <strong><a href="/ksiazki/cshta2.htm" style="color:black;" title="C#. Tworzenie aplikacji sieciowych. Gotowe projekty">C#. Tworzenie aplikacji sieciowych. Gotowe projekty</a></strong><br/> <img src="/img/5.gif" class="stars" /> <table cellpadding="0" cellspacing="0" style="margin:0 auto;"> <tr> <td style="width:129px;height:24px;background:url(/img/tlopodkoszyk2.gif) no-repeat scroll 0 4px;padding-left:5px;"> <b>Cena: 49.00 zł</b> </td><td> <a href="/zakupy/add.cgi?id=cshta2"><img class="stars" src="/img/koszyk2.gif" alt="Dodaj cshta2" /></a> </td> </tr> </table> <strong><a href="/ksiazki/algor4.htm" style="color:black;" title="Algorytmy. Wydanie IV">Algorytmy. Wydanie IV</a></strong><br/> <img src="/img/5.gif" class="stars" /> <table cellpadding="0" cellspacing="0" style="margin:0 auto;"> <tr> <td style="width:129px;height:24px;background:url(/img/tlopodkoszyk2.gif) no-repeat scroll 0 4px;padding-left:5px;"> <b>Cena: 149.00 zł</b> </td><td> <a href="/zakupy/add.cgi?id=algor4"><img class="stars" src="/img/koszyk2.gif" alt="Dodaj algor4" /></a> </td> </tr> </table> <strong><a href="/ksiazki/cpprim.htm" style="color:black;" title="Język C++. Szkoła programowania. Wydanie V">Język C++. Szkoła programowania. Wydanie V</a></strong><br/> <img src="/img/55.gif" class="stars" /> <table cellpadding="0" cellspacing="0" style="margin:0 auto;"> <tr> <td style="width:129px;height:24px;background:url(/img/tlopodkoszyk2.gif) no-repeat scroll 0 4px;padding-left:5px;"> <b>Cena: 99.00 zł</b> </td><td> <a href="/zakupy/add.cgi?id=cpprim"><img class="stars" src="/img/koszyk2.gif" alt="Dodaj cpprim" /></a> </td> </tr> </table> <strong><a href="/ksiazki/libi21.htm" style="color:black;" title="Linux. Biblia. Ubuntu, Fedora, Debian i 15 innych dystrybucji">Linux. Biblia. Ubuntu, Fedora, Debian i 15 innych dystrybucji</a></strong><br/> <img src="/img/5.gif" class="stars" /> <table cellpadding="0" cellspacing="0" style="margin:0 auto;"> <tr> <td style="width:129px;height:24px;background:url(/img/tlopodkoszyk2.gif) no-repeat scroll 0 4px;padding-left:5px;"> <b>Cena: 99.00 zł</b> </td><td> <a href="/zakupy/add.cgi?id=libi21"><img class="stars" src="/img/koszyk2.gif" alt="Dodaj libi21" /></a> </td> </tr> </table> <strong><a href="/ksiazki/linobj.htm" style="color:black;" title="LINQ to Objects w C# 4.0">LINQ to Objects w C# 4.0</a></strong><br/> <div style="height:8px;"></div> <table cellpadding="0" cellspacing="0" style="margin:0 auto;"> <tr> <td style="width:129px;height:24px;background:url(/img/tlopodkoszyk2.gif) no-repeat scroll 0 4px;padding-left:5px;"> <b>Cena: 49.00 zł</b> </td><td> <a href="/zakupy/add.cgi?id=linobj"><img class="stars" src="/img/koszyk2.gif" alt="Dodaj linobj" /></a> </td> </tr> </table> <strong><a href="/ksiazki/winazu.htm" style="color:black;" title="Windows Azure. Wprowadzenie do programowania w chmurze">Windows Azure. Wprowadzenie do programowania w chmurze</a></strong><br/> <div style="height:8px;"></div> <table cellpadding="0" cellspacing="0" style="margin:0 auto;"> <tr> <td style="width:129px;height:24px;background:url(/img/tlopodkoszyk2.gif) no-repeat scroll 0 4px;padding-left:5px;"> <b>Cena: 39.00 zł</b> </td><td> <a href="/zakupy/add.cgi?id=winazu"><img class="stars" src="/img/koszyk2.gif" alt="Dodaj winazu" /></a> </td> </tr> </table> <strong><a href="/ksiazki/sievpn_ebook.htm" style="color:black;" title="Sieci VPN. Zdalna praca i bezpieczeństwo danych. eBook. ">Sieci VPN. Zdalna praca i bezpieczeństwo danych. eBook. </a></strong><br/> <div style="height:8px;"></div> <table cellpadding="0" cellspacing="0" style="margin:0 auto;"> <tr> <td style="width:129px;height:24px;background:url(/img/tlopodkoszyk2.gif) no-repeat scroll 0 4px;padding-left:5px;"> <b>Cena: 19.90 zł</b> </td><td> <a href="/zakupy/add.cgi?id=sievpn_ebook"><img class="stars" src="/img/koszyk2.gif" alt="Dodaj sievpn_ebook" /></a> </td> </tr> </table> <strong><a href="/ksiazki/ticpp2.htm" style="color:black;" title="Tablice informatyczne. C++. Wydanie II">Tablice informatyczne. C++. Wydanie II</a></strong><br/> <div style="height:8px;"></div> <table cellpadding="0" cellspacing="0" style="margin:0 auto;"> <tr> <td style="width:129px;height:24px;background:url(/img/tlopodkoszyk2.gif) no-repeat scroll 0 4px;padding-left:5px;"> <b>Cena: 12.90 zł</b> </td><td> <a href="/zakupy/add.cgi?id=ticpp2"><img class="stars" src="/img/koszyk2.gif" alt="Dodaj ticpp2" /></a> </td> </tr> </table> <strong><a href="/ksiazki/and3ta.htm" style="color:black;" title="Android 3. Tworzenie aplikacji">Android 3. Tworzenie aplikacji</a></strong><br/> <div style="height:8px;"></div> <table cellpadding="0" cellspacing="0" style="margin:0 auto;"> <tr> <td style="width:129px;height:24px;background:url(/img/tlopodkoszyk2.gif) no-repeat scroll 0 4px;padding-left:5px;"> <b>Cena: 149.00 zł</b> </td><td> <a href="/zakupy/add.cgi?id=and3ta"><img class="stars" src="/img/koszyk2.gif" alt="Dodaj and3ta" /></a> </td> </tr> </table> <strong><a href="/ksiazki/wfcodp_ebook.htm" style="color:black;" title="WCF od podstaw. Komunikacja sieciowa nowej generacji. eBook. ">WCF od podstaw. Komunikacja sieciowa nowej generacji. eBook. </a></strong><br/> <div style="height:8px;"></div> <table cellpadding="0" cellspacing="0" style="margin:0 auto;"> <tr> <td style="width:129px;height:24px;background:url(/img/tlopodkoszyk2.gif) no-repeat scroll 0 4px;padding-left:5px;"> <b>Cena: 39.00 zł</b> </td><td> <a href="/zakupy/add.cgi?id=wfcodp_ebook"><img class="stars" src="/img/koszyk2.gif" alt="Dodaj wfcodp_ebook" /></a> </td> </tr> </table>
6
(1)
5
(4)
4
(2)
3
(2)
2
(0)
1
(0)

Liczba ocen: 9

Średnia ocena
czytelników
4


C++. Wykorzystaj potęgę aplikacji graficznych:

miniaturka cppwyk

Ocena : 6 Ocena książki 2009-03-19

bez podpisu

Po pierwsze WIELKIE dzięki dla autorów za tak wspaniały pomysł napisania o bibliotekach wxWidgets i Qt. Książka jest napisana super językiem, po prostu dla każdego.Ale jeśli autorzy będą procować nad drugim wydaniem to dobrze by było w nim położyć większy nacisk na pomoc tym którzy piszą kod samodzielnie i opisać sposób instalacji tych bibliotek w Microsoft Visual Studio. Wtedy nie będzie lepszej książki na rynku Polskim, ani zagranicznym;P

Ocena : 5 Ocena książki 2008-09-16

bez podpisu

Świetna, chyba pierwsza taka książka, Nobla Autorowi! ;]

Ocena : 5 Ocena książki 2008-08-29

Amper

Super książeczka! Wreszcie coś o pisaniu dla różnych systemów. Można by więcej o kompilacji.

Ocena : 5 Ocena książki 2010-01-18

Jacek

Książka jest chyba jedyną taką pozycją na rynku polskim, która od strony praktycznej opisuje zarówno wxWidgets jak i Qt4. Oczywiście trudno jednym skromnym tomie wyczerpująco opisać wszystko i zadowolić wszyskich. Ale jako wstęp do programowania z wykorzystaniem tych obszernych bibliotek, bardzo dobra. Polecam.

Ocena : 5 Ocena książki 2008-11-19

bez podpisu

Ocena : 4 Ocena książki 2009-09-22

bez podpisu

Panowie autorzy popełnili błąd typowy dla autorów książek uczących programowania - mianowicie nie wykonali kroków według swoich wskazówek sprawdzając czy wszystko działa. Programy, czy to wklepane, czy skopiowane z płyty, nie linkują się. Co prawda, wystarczy napisać w książce, by projekt kompilować według załączonego na CD-ROMie pliku makefile.win (do każdego projektu jest inny makefile). Ale to trzeba napisać. Początkujący rozłoży się na linkowaniu pierwszego przykładu 2-go rozdziału.

Ocena : 4 Ocena książki 2011-03-10

bez podpisu

Książka dobra, ale nie daję wyższej oceny, gdyż autor wplata opisywane zagadnienia w zbyt duże przykłady, bardzo często rozwijane z poprzednich przykładów. Zatraca się przy tym przejrzystość opisu właściwych rzeczy. Po co np. przy opisywaniu najprostszego rysowania wykonywać na starcie program mający dużo więcej funkcji (rysowanie myszą, dobór parametrów rysowania oknami dialogowymi). Bardzo ciężko korzysta się z tej książki z doskoku, jeśli zachodzi potrzeba przypomnienia sobie istoty działania konkretnego zagadnienia. Jako kurs ok, ale nie jako książka, do której można sięgać dorywczo.

Ocena : 3 Ocena książki 2009-09-22

bez podpisu

Szanuję twórców tego dzieła za ich kolosalną wiedzę, jednak książka sama w sobie jest przereklamowana, a informacje w niej zawarte nie są jakoś super ujęte. Może wynika to z mojej niedostatecznej wiedzy na temat programowania, gdyż na co dzień programuję w : C++, PHP, C#, ActionScript :)

Ocena : 3 Ocena książki 2010-01-04

cyryllo

Kupiłem ją ponad rok temu. Pozycja taka sobie. Za dużo skakania i za mało dobrych przykładów. Nie polecam początkującym.